Buying Guide
When selecting an RTV for thermostat housing, focus on temperature tolerance, chemical compatibility, and ease of application, as these directly affect seal integrity and long‑term performance.
Key factors buyers should consider
Quality
Look for RTVs formulated specifically for high‑temperature environments and compatible with the plastics or metals used in thermostat housings. A high gel‑content silicone base resists shrinkage, while a low‑VOC formula ensures a clean cure.
Certifications such as UL‑94V‑0 or ISO‑9001 add confidence in material integrity and long‑term performance under varying temperature cycles.
Features
Choose an RTV that offers a balanced set of features, including a medium‑strength bond, resistance to oil and coolant, and a cure time that fits your workflow.
A built‑in release liner simplifies application, while a non‑corrosive formula protects nearby metal components from chemical attack and ensures reliable sealing during prolonged service intervals.
Durability
Durability hinges on the RTV’s ability to withstand thermal cycling, vibration, and exposure to automotive fluids. Look for products rated for at least 200 °C continuous service and proven resistance to ozone and UV radiation.
A flexible shore hardness of 30–40 ensures the seal remains intact despite housing movement over many years of use.

Frequently Asked Questions
What RTV silicone is best for sealing a thermostat housing?
A high‑temperature, 100 % silicone RTV such as Permatex Ultra Grey or Loctite 567 is ideal. It tolerates 300 °F (150 °C) cycles, adheres to metal and most plastics, remains flexible, preventing cracks under engine heat, for automotive applications and long‑term reliability.
How thick should the RTV bead be when sealing a thermostat housing?
Apply a continuous bead about 1/8 inch (3 mm) thick around the housing flange. This thickness fills gaps, compensates for surface irregularities, and provides enough material for a secure seal after curing, without excess that could squeeze into the coolant passage, or overflow into the thermostat housing cavity during installation and operation.
Can I use the same RTV for both metal and plastic thermostat housings?
Yes, most high‑temperature RTVs bond to metal and common plastics like ABS or polycarbonate. However, verify the product’s compatibility chart; some formulas contain solvents that can stress certain polymers.
Choose a neutral‑cure silicone when sealing delicate plastic components to ensure a long‑lasting, leak‑free seal that withstands thermal cycling and pressure.
How long should I let the RTV cure before reinstalling the thermostat?
Allow the RTV to cure for at least 24 hours at ambient temperature (70 °F/21 °C). Full strength develops after 48 hours, which is recommended for high‑heat zones.
Rushing the cure can lead to soft spots and eventual coolant leaks or reduced sealing performance, especially in engines that experience rapid temperature changes during start‑up.
